MDEV-10411 Providing compatibility for basic PL/SQL constructs

An additional change for "Part 9: EXCEPTION handlers"

This construct:
  EXCEPTION WHEN OTHERS THEN ...;
now catches warning-alike conditions, e.g. NO_DATA_FOUND.
